Мазмуну:
- 1 -кадам: Колдонулган түшүнүк
- 2 -кадам: Аппараттык жабдуулар жана анын туташуулары
- 3 -кадам: Коддоо
- 4 -кадам: Үйрөткүч видео
Video: Дүйнөнүн каалаган жеринен сенсордун баалуулугун түз көзөмөлдөө: 4 кадам
2024 Автор: John Day | [email protected]. Акыркы өзгөртүү: 2024-01-30 10:42
Мен techiesmsтин WhatsApp номерине бир долбоорду ишке ашырууга жардам тууралуу билдирүү алдым. Долбоор басым сенсорунун басымын өлчөө жана аны смартфонго көрсөтүү болчу. Ошентип, мен бул долбоорду түзүүгө жардам бердим жана смартфонуңуздагы сенсорлордун маалыматтарын көзөмөлдөө боюнча үйрөтмө видео тартууну чечтим.
1 -кадам: Колдонулган түшүнүк
Мен эң популярдуу тактаны iot менен байланышкан ESP8266 долбоорлору үчүн колдондум. Азыр биз билгендей, рынокто бар сенсорлордун көпчүлүгү бизге аналогдук түрдө чыгарууну берет, ошондуктан мен esp8266 01 модулунун аналогдук пини жок болгондуктан esp8266 01 модулунун ордуна esp8266 12e өнүктүрүү тактасын тандап алгам, ал эми esp 12eде 1 аналогдук пин бар. ичинде. Андан кийин мен түшүнүктү түшүндүрүү үчүн 14.7 мм Force Sensitive Resistor (FSR) колдондум, бирок сиз каалаган сенсорду колдоно аласыз. Ошентип, сенсор басылганда, ар кандай чыңалуу мааниси биздин esp тактабыздын 0 аналогдук пининде пайда болот жана esp платасы бул окууну Adafruit IO серверинде MQTT протоколу аркылуу жарыялайт. Ал эми акылдуу телефон тарапта, Google playstore'дон IoT MQTT Dashboard аттуу колдонмону орнотушубуз керек.
2 -кадам: Аппараттык жабдуулар жана анын туташуулары
Мен колдонгон бул долбоор үчүн,
- ESP8266 12e өнүктүрүү тактасы-> (https://techiesms.com/products/esp8266-12e-development-boardnodemcu/)
- Күч сезимтал каршылыгы (FSR)-> (https://techiesms.com/products/force-sensor/)
ЭСКЕРТҮҮ:- Компоненттерди өзүбүздүн дүкөндөн сатып алыңыз (techiesms дүкөнү). Продукциялардын шилтемеси жогоруда көрсөтүлгөн
Бул долбоордун аппараттык байланыштары мындай,
3 -кадам: Коддоо
Coding үчүн сиз системаңызга Arduino акыркы версиясын жүктөп алышыңыз керек, андан кийин сиз Adafruit MQTT китепканасын орнотушуңуз керек, анткени биз бул долбоордо Adafruit MQTT серверин колдонобуз.
Мен кодду, долбоордун иштешин, колдонмонун конфигурациясын, ал тургай Adafruitте эсеп жазууну төмөндө көрсөтүлгөн видеодо абдан деталдуу түрдө түшүндүрдүм. Ошентип, бул долбоорго байланыштуу бардык нерсени билүү үчүн бул видеону көрүңүз.
4 -кадам: Үйрөткүч видео
Мен кодду, долбоордун иштешин, колдонмонун конфигурациясын жана ал тургай Adafruitте эсеп жазууну төмөндө көрсөтүлгөн видеодо абдан деталдуу түрдө түшүндүрдүм. Ошентип, бул проектке байланыштуу баарын билүү үчүн бул видеону көрүңүз.
Сунушталууда:
Пиңизге дүйнөнүн каалаган жеринен коопсуз кирүү: 7 кадам
Пиңизге дүйнөнүн каалаган жеринен коопсуз кирүү: Пи боюнча күнү -түнү иштеген бир нече тиркемелерим бар. Мен үйүмдөн качан чыкканымда Пинин ден соолугун жана абалын текшерүү абдан кыйын болуп калды. Кийинчерээк ngrok аркылуу кичинекей тоскоолдукту жеңдим. Түзмөккө сырттан кирүү
Дүйнөнүн каалаган жеринен үнүңүздү башкарыңыз: 5 кадам
Дүйнөнүн каалаган жеринен үнүңүздү башкарыңыз: … фантастика эмес … Бүгүнкү күндө жеткиликтүү болгон аппараттык жана программалык камсыздоону колдонуп, бул Нускоо үн башкаруу, смартфон, планшет жана/же компьютер каалаган жерден
Баасы төмөн Smart Home - Дүйнөнүн каалаган жеринен башкаруу: 6 кадам
Төмөн Наркы Акылдуу Үй - ДҮЙНӨНҮН каалаган жеринен башкаруу: Учурда эки ата -эне тең үй -бүлө үчүн жайлуу жашоо үчүн иштеп жатышат. Ошентип, биздин үйдө жылыткыч, AC, кир жуугуч машина жана башкалар сыяктуу көптөгөн электроникалык шаймандар бар
Мобилдик башкарылуучу роботту кантип жасоо керек - DTMF негизделген - Микроконтроллерсиз & Программасыз - Дүйнөнүн каалаган жеринен башкаруу - RoboGeeks: 15 кадам
Мобилдик башкарылуучу роботту кантип жасоо керек | DTMF негизделген | Микроконтроллерсиз & Программасыз | Дүйнөнүн каалаган жеринен башкаруу | RoboGeeks: Дүйнөнүн каалаган бурчунан башкарыла турган робот жасагыңыз келет, муну жасаңыз
Дүйнөнүн каалаган жеринен ESP8266 башкарыңыз: 4 кадам
Дүйнө жүзүнүн каалаган жеринен ESP8266ңызды башкарыңыз: Мен кантип ESP8266ны каалаган жерден башкара алам жана Интернеттен көзөмөлдөө үчүн роутер портумду орнотуунун кереги жок? Менде бул көйгөйдүн чечими бар. Мен жазган жөнөкөй PhP-Server менен, сиз каалаган жерде ESP8266 башкаруу ESP8266 GPIO кошо аласыз